/* PAGE 1073 - FORMATION CONTINUE + COWORKING */
.page-id-1073 #primary{background:#000}
.page-id-1073 .description01{max-width:70rem;padding:0 1rem;background:#121212;}
.page-id-1073 .fc-wrapper{background:transparent;color:#E1E1E1}
.page-id-1073 .fc-wrapper li{list-style:disc;margin:.5rem 0 0 1rem}
.page-id-1073 .wp-block-list{padding-bottom:2rem}
.page-id-1073 .wp-block-heading{padding:0}
.page-id-1073 hr{margin:3rem auto}
.page-id-1073 strong{color:#6eafe9!important}
.page-id-1073 h3{text-align:center;margin:2rem auto}
.page-id-1073 h3 strong{color:#fff!important;text-transform:uppercase}
.page-id-1073 #formacadre .wp-block-media-text__content {height: auto;padding: 0 1rem;align-self: flex-start;}

.page-id-1073 .txtimg2 figure {align-self: self-start !important;}
.page-id-1073 .txtimg2 img {width:30rem !important}
.page-id-1073 .txtimg2 .wp-block-list {padding-bottom: 0.7rem}
.page-id-1073 .txtimg2 p {margin:0 auto 2rem !important;}

.page-id-1073 .txtimg1 figure {align-self: self-start !important;}
.page-id-1073 .txtimg1 img {width:30rem !important}
.page-id-1073 .txtimg1 .wp-block-list {padding-bottom: 0.7rem}
.page-id-1073 .txtimg1 p {margin:0 auto 2rem !important;}
.page-id-1073 .txtimg1 .wp-block-media-text__content {padding: 0 1rem 0 0 !important;width: 38rem !important;}

/* Bandeau d’alerte de cette page (non scoped dans le CSS d’origine) */
.warningforms{display:flex;align-items:center;gap:1rem;text-align:center;border:1px solid #FF0;justify-content:space-between;padding:1rem 0}
.warnleft,.warnright{font-size:3rem}
.warnleft{padding-left:2rem}
.warnright{padding-right:2rem}
.warntext{font-size:1.4rem;width:40rem}

/* Formulaire */
.page-id-1073 .fluentform {color: white; background: #F9F9F9; padding: 0 1rem 1rem; margin: 2rem auto}
.page-id-1073 .fluentform label {display: none}
.page-id-1073 .fluentform .ff-el-group {margin-bottom: 0;}

#formamobile {display: none}

@media screen and (min-width:1px) and (max-width:999px){
    #formacadre {display: none}
    #formamobile {display: block; padding: 1vw; margin: 0 1vw; background: #121212;}
    #formamobile .warningforms {margin: 1rem auto}
    #formamobile .ff_submit_btn_wrapper button { width: 100%; background: #578dbc;}
}
@media screen and (min-width:1px) and (max-width:1200px){
    article .entry-content {background: none}
}
/*
@media screen and (min-width:1px) and (max-width:1200px){
.page-id-1073 #formacadre .wp-block-media-text__content {max-width: 30rem !important;}
.page-id-1073 #formacadre .wp-block-media-text__media {max-width: fit-content;} 
.page-id-1073 #formacadre .wp-block-media-text__media img {max-width: 30rem !important; margin: 0;padding: 0;} 
}
*/